安装配置Tomcat + Apache + mod_jk(转)[@more@]方案优势:配置简单高效,避免了编译webapp.so的麻烦
方案缺点:linux下的mod_jk也很难找.
1.安装JDK,这个很简单,执行
./j2sdk1.4.1_02.bin
cp -R j2sdk1.4.1_02/ /usr/local/j2sdk141
export JAVA_HOME=/usr/local/j2sdk141
export PATH=$PATH:/usr/local/j2sdk141/bin:/usr/local/j2sdk141/jre/bin
export CLASSPATH=="./:/usr/local/j2sdk141/lib:/usr/local/j2sdk141/jre/lib" #设置环境变量
2.安装Tomcat4.1.29,将下载下来的tomcat1.4.29.tar.gz解压拷贝到相应的目录即可
tar xvzf tomcat4.1.29.tar.gz
cp tomcat4.1.29 /usr/local/tomcat4
export CATALINA_HOME=/usr/local/tomcat4 # 设置环境变量
3.安装apache,redhat都自带的,我装的是redhat9自带的2.40.20
4.装mod_jk,我装的是mod_jk-tomcat4.1.18-rh80.i386.rpm,支持tomcat4.xx和httpd2.xx系列的版本.
注意,只有将jdk和tomcat装在特定的目录下mod_jk才能检测到,所以这里我们强制安装
rpm -i --nodeps mod_jk.rpm
好了,现在需要的软件都安装完了,剩下的就是配置的工作.
5.mod_jk的配置
cd /etc/httpd/conf/
vi mod_jk.properties
修改workers.tomcat_home为tomcat的安装目录,workers.java_home为jdk的安装目录,需要注意的是该文件默认连接tomcat的端口是8109,但实际上在tomcat上默认的是8009,所以这里也要修改一下.
workers.tomcat_home=/usr/local/tomcat4
workers.java_home=/usr/local/j2sdk141
worker.list=ajp13
worker.ajp13.port=8009
worker.ajp13.host=localhost
worker.ajp13.type=ajp13
6.apache的配置
vi httpd.conf
在LoadModule处增加下面一行
LoadModule jk_module modules/mod_jk.so
另外要增加mod_jk的配置文件
方案缺点:linux下的mod_jk也很难找.
1.安装JDK,这个很简单,执行
./j2sdk1.4.1_02.bin
cp -R j2sdk1.4.1_02/ /usr/local/j2sdk141
export JAVA_HOME=/usr/local/j2sdk141
export PATH=$PATH:/usr/local/j2sdk141/bin:/usr/local/j2sdk141/jre/bin
export CLASSPATH=="./:/usr/local/j2sdk141/lib:/usr/local/j2sdk141/jre/lib" #设置环境变量
2.安装Tomcat4.1.29,将下载下来的tomcat1.4.29.tar.gz解压拷贝到相应的目录即可
tar xvzf tomcat4.1.29.tar.gz
cp tomcat4.1.29 /usr/local/tomcat4
export CATALINA_HOME=/usr/local/tomcat4 # 设置环境变量
3.安装apache,redhat都自带的,我装的是redhat9自带的2.40.20
4.装mod_jk,我装的是mod_jk-tomcat4.1.18-rh80.i386.rpm,支持tomcat4.xx和httpd2.xx系列的版本.
注意,只有将jdk和tomcat装在特定的目录下mod_jk才能检测到,所以这里我们强制安装
rpm -i --nodeps mod_jk.rpm
好了,现在需要的软件都安装完了,剩下的就是配置的工作.
5.mod_jk的配置
cd /etc/httpd/conf/
vi mod_jk.properties
修改workers.tomcat_home为tomcat的安装目录,workers.java_home为jdk的安装目录,需要注意的是该文件默认连接tomcat的端口是8109,但实际上在tomcat上默认的是8009,所以这里也要修改一下.
workers.tomcat_home=/usr/local/tomcat4
workers.java_home=/usr/local/j2sdk141
worker.list=ajp13
worker.ajp13.port=8009
worker.ajp13.host=localhost
worker.ajp13.type=ajp13
6.apache的配置
vi httpd.conf
在LoadModule处增加下面一行
LoadModule jk_module modules/mod_jk.so
另外要增加mod_jk的配置文件
QUOTE: 来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/10617542/viewspace-945747/,如需转载,请注明出处,否则将追究法律责任。
请登录后发表评论
登录
全部评论
<%=items[i].createtime%>
<%=items[i].content%> <%if(items[i].items.items.length) { %>
<%for(var j=0;j
<%}%> <%}%>
<%=items[i].items.items[j].createtime%>
<%=items[i].items.items[j].username%> 回复 <%=items[i].items.items[j].tousername%>: <%=items[i].items.items[j].content%>
还有<%=items[i].items.total-5%>条评论
) data-count=1 data-flag=true>点击查看
<%}%>
|
转载于:http://blog.itpub.net/10617542/viewspace-945747/